MARINE CITY Jay B. Basney, 59 of 165 South Water, died Sunday in Mt. Clemens General Hospital.

He was born April 14, 1915, in El Paso, Illinois, and was a lifelong area resident.

Mr. Basney married Dorothy G. Coon May 27, 1968, in Warren.

He was a retired safety engineer at General Motors Technical Center.

Mr. Basney is survived by his wife, a daughter, Jay Ann, Algonac, his mother, Mrs. Mary M. Basney, Algonac, a sister Mrs. Lee Larson, Stewart, Florida and two grandchildren.

Funeral services will be held at 11 a.m. Wednesday in Gilbert Funeral Home. Rev. Robert E. Moehring, of St. Peter's Church, Fair Haven, will officiate.

Burial will be in Oaklawn Cemetery. Remains are in the funeral home, with visiting hours 1 to 9 p.m. Tuesday

Memorials may be made to the Michigan Heart Association.
